Default A Little Help, What Do You Guys Think About This Deal?

I would really appreciate the help here guys. I am lookint at a Black 2002 WS6 M6 with 50K miles on it, and it's a dealer car. I got the guy down to 17.5K. EXTERIOR: No Dings or dents at all, and no scratches. However the nose will need to be repainted due to bug damage (It is a southern car and I guess if you dont clean the bugs off they are very acidic and eat through the paint). Also there are 2 quater-sized spots on the hood where the clear coat has chipped/bubbled off. DRIVE-TRAIN: The engine sounds good, there is a little bit of engine noise but it sounds like it is coming from the top-end (noisy valvetrain most-likey), I think I am just paranoid because I am about to spend alot of money(to me anyway), and I am just afraid of buying a car that blows-up, the guy said they did an oil change with 5-30 synthetic. Other than that the engine is stock besides and aftermarket lid and a SLP MAF. INTERIOR: Is nearly perfect with the exception of a seatbelt holder on the headrest is missing on one side. And there is a small plate behind the wiper switch on the steering column which is missing. The guy said that he would fix both of these for free if I bought it.
What do you guys think? I would appreciate any help, should I take it or pass on it?

Originally Posted by BirdsOnly
Actually my friend will be paying for it all, Mr. Cash, lol. Do think I would be able to talk him down some more if I am buying it outright?
If your paying cash hell yes!! make him work for the sale! Only the dealer knows what he has into it and its all a numbers game. But you have cash which can be worked to the dealers advantage on taxes. Ask to speak with the manager about it. Tell him your paying cash and want his best deal or your going elswhere. Black is black but if your paint if faded not much they can do to color match except blend it best they can on the car. As far as the repairs pro'lly half hour to an hour of repair time and then like 1.5 hrs to paint plus materials maybe. I'm looking at an estimate I just had done to touch up my car and guessing what yours would be.
